HMRRF是做什么的?

Hammer Metals Limited, originally incorporated as Midas Resources Limited in 2000 and rebranded in 2014, is an Australian mineral exploration company dedicated to discovering and developing valuable mineral resources. The company's core focus lies in exploring for iron oxide, copper, cobalt, and gold deposits, with additional interest in molybdenum and rhenium ores. Hammer Metals' flagship asset is the Mount Isa project, a sprawling 2,600 square kilometer area within the prolific Mount Isa mining district in Queensland, Australia. This project encompasses several key deposits, including Kalman, Overlander North and South, and Elaine. Additionally, Hammer Metals holds a 51% interest in the Jubilee deposit, further solidifying its presence in the region. Beyond Mount Isa, the company also maintains a 100% interest in the Bronzewing South gold project, situated in the Yandal Belt of Western Australia, a region renowned for its gold mining activity. Hammer Metals is based in West Perth, Australia, and continues to actively explore and evaluate its tenements for potential resource development.

HMRRF在哪个行业运营?

Hammer Metals operates within the Australian mineral exploration industry, a sector characterized by high risk and high potential reward. The industry is influenced by global commodity prices, exploration success rates, and regulatory environments. Competition is intense, with numerous companies vying for prospective mineral tenements. The Mount Isa region, where Hammer Metals holds a significant land position, is a well-established mining district with existing infrastructure, providing a potential advantage. The Yandal Belt, home to the Bronzewing South project, is a prolific gold-producing region.
